About the company
ASA Gold and Precious Metals Limited is a publicly owned investment manager. The firm invests in the public equity markets across the globe. It primarily invests in stocks of companies engaged in the exploration, mining or processing of gold, silver, platinum, diamonds, or other precious minerals. It also invests in exchange traded funds. The firm employs fundamental analysis with a bottom-up approach to create its portfolios. The firm obtains external research to complement its in-house research. The firm is focused on covering the metals and mining sector. This record reflects the investment preferences or overall investment strategy of ASA Gold and Precious Metals Limited. ASA Gold and Precious Metals Limited was founded in 1958 and is based in Portland, Maine.
